Understanding "Good Morning" in Greek

In Greek, "good morning" is said as Καλημέρα (Kaliméra). This simple phrase is more than just a way to greet someone. It conveys a wish for a good day ahead and is commonly used across Greece. Whether you’re visiting the stunning islands or enjoying a lively town in mainland Greece, saying Καλημέρα is an essential part of local etiquette.
What is the proper context for using Καλημέρα?
Καλημέρα is typically used in the morning until around noon. It’s a casual and friendly greeting, perfect for both formal and informal interactions. By using it, you show respect and friendliness to those around you.
